## Releases

Hey support folks — quick notes on ProfileMesh shard releases. Each release re-balances user-profile shards gradually, so don't panic if a lookup lands on a stale shard for a few minutes post-deploy; it self-heals. Release bundles are published twice a month and are always signed. If a customer asks you to verify a bundle they downloaded, walk them through the checksum step using the public signing key below.

deploy key for kawif-bageg: bky19_YQNdHDgpaLxUNwPoHm9

## Further Reading

Maintainers working on Driftpane's chunked diff engine should understand how the streaming tokenizer interacts with the memory-mapped file reader before touching anything in the hunk alignment code. The original design rationale, including why we rejected a rope-based buffer and how the 64MB window threshold was chosen, is documented in depth by the Corvid team's architecture notes. Benchmarks against the legacy viewer are included there as well. The full design document lives on our internal wiki, linked below.

wiki page, tahaf-tajog: https://jira.ordindyn.corp/pipeline

## Authentication

Quick heads-up before you dive into the PointsPerch ledger code: every write to the loyalty ledger goes through the Tallyhawk internal gateway, so there's no direct DB access anywhere in this repo. Good. The gateway expects a service key on each request via the `X-Tallyhawk-Key` header, and the middleware in `auth/verify.js` handles attaching it. For local review runs, you'll want the staging key loaded into your env. Use the key below:

service key, kaduf-bawig: kto15_Ze79S0dligTw0yO